Mark G. Stockholm, 56, of Hudson

Hudson – Mark G. Stockholm, 56, died unexpectedly Wednesday, Jan. 20, 2016 from injuries he suffered in a fall.

He was born May 21, 1959 in Seattle and spent his childhood years living with his family in Acton. He had been a resident of Hudson since 1988. He was the son of Gordon Stockholm and the late Joy (Casto) Stockholm) and H. Dale Hicks.

Mark was the chef/co-owner for Classic Occasions Caterer for the past 24 years, servicing many events throughout the local region.

Mark leaves his loving wife of 26 years, Nadine M. (Wurtz ) Stockholm of Hudson, and was the devoted father of Tricia (Thering) Bowen and her husband John, Jon Thering and his wife Kimberly, Lauren (Stockholm) Sherman and her husband Joshua, and Peter Stockholm. He was the brother of Tracy Brown and Matthew Hicks. He is also survived by his three grandchildren, Brandon Thering, MacKenzie, and Kaylynn Bowen, and many nieces and nephews.

A service will be celebrated Wednesday, Jan. 27, at 10 a.m., in Tighe-Hamilton Chapel next to the funeral home. Burial will follow in Forestvale Cemetery of Hudson. Family and friends may attend calling hours Tuesday, Jan. 26, from 4-8 p.m., in the Tighe-Hamilton Funeral Home, 50 Central St., Hudson.

In lieu of flowers, the family has asked that donations be made to The Christopher and Dana Reeve Foundation.
